what is the difference between the vedic religion and zoroastrianism

Respuesta :

KenjiLuv
KenjiLuv KenjiLuv
  • 01-10-2018
They invoke the same deities, and their metre of recitation of scriptures is the same. Zoroastrianism was founded by Zarathustra, who reformed the ancient Avestan religion into a new direction. ... There are a lot of similarities between the Vedas of Hinduism and Gathas of Zoroastrianism.
